Sen. Ted Cruz and Donald Trump Jr. dine in Dallas
WFAA-TV ^ | March 11, 2017 | Hannah Davis

Posted on 03/11/2017 2:34:01 PM PST by 2ndDivisionVet

DALLAS -- Texas Senator Ted Cruz and Donald Trump Jr. will headline the Reagan Day Dinner hosted by the Dallas County Republican's Party Saturday evening.

The event will take place at the Omni Hotel in downtown Dallas and includes a meet and greet with Republican leaders and dinner. Attendees have to purchase tickets starting at $150 and going up to $25,000.

This is the second meeting between the Trump family and Ted Cruz in recent weeks. Senator Cruz and his wife recently had dinner with President Trump, tweeting a photo of the Cruz family's children with the President afterwards.
